入选标准
- •a. Dementia according to international guidelines (any etiology)
- •b. Behavioral or psychological symptoms (BPSD) for which additional care or intervention is needed (according to treating specialist)
- •c. Agreement and informed consent from patient or formal family/care givers for participation
- •d. Practical feasibility of professional music therapy, during 3 joined weeks, 3 days a week
- •e. Availability of activity coaches or care professionals who can adjust the passive music (GDI) or activities (PSI) based on instructions during introductory course.
- •f. Availability of some room and the time needed for a test assistent (TA) for the administration of psychometric scales.
- •g. The participant has no limitations of hearing or sensory disturbance which seriously interfere with any of the interventions.
排除标准
- •a. Exclusion of causes (somatic or contextual) for which pharmacological or other treatment is needed first
- •b. Refusal of patient or formal caregivers (particularly also in the case of incompetence of will)
- •c. Delirium
- •d. New psychopharmacological treatment in past 2 weeks
- •e Hearing loss or disturbance of consciousness
- •f. Palliative care setting or life expectancy < 2 months
- •g. No guarantee that care or intervention can be continued
- •h. Senosory disturbances that seriously interfere with any of the interventions
